INTRODUCTION
Both managers and scientists often tell us that companies need to be exible, adaptable, and agile.
Faced with unpredictable competitors, they have to be in a constant state of a kind of alert, ready for
changes, and developing new skills. In the face of a new economics, it makes sense for companies to
pursue ever-greater levels of exibility—exibility and change are requirements. Companies usually
reinvent themselves because competitors with more attractive products or efcient production sys-
